John Dramani Mahama is scheduled to travel to France on Monday for a series of high-level engagements, including participation in a global health summit and bilateral talks with Emmanuel Macron, according to Ghana’s presidency.
Mr. Mahama will begin his visit in Lyon, where he is set to attend the 2026 One Health Summit, a gathering of world leaders and health officials focused on strengthening international coordination on health systems, food security and emerging global threats. He is expected to co-chair a high-level segment of the summit alongside Mr. Macron.
The Ghanaian leader will deliver keynote remarks on global health architecture and outline his country’s position on health security, including commitments to address evolving public health risks. The summit will also feature participation from senior international officials, including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us of the World Health Organization.
Following the summit, Mr. Mahama will travel to Paris for meetings at the Élysée Palace, where discussions with Mr. Macron are expected to center on expanding cooperation in areas such as health, education, trade, investment and regional security.
Mr. Mahama is also scheduled to meet Gérard Larcher before concluding his visit and returning to Accra.
